Russell County AL E911 Deploys GeoConex NextGen Map Viewer and Zetron 911 Phone System

Feb 10 2015

February 10, 2015:  GeoConex® Corporation assisted Russell County E-911 with the replacement of their aging phone system with a Zetron MAX Call-Taking Next Generation 9-1-1 telecommunications system.  GeoConex® is an authorized dealer for Zetron mission-critical communications solutions.  Additionally, this project included the installation of GeoConex®’s Next Generation Map Viewer. 

The relationship between GeoConex® and Russell County began several years ago when Russell County chose GeoConex® to provide an ESRI based GIS creation and manipulation program for their 911 digital map data. After evaluating several vendor’s products, Rod Powell, E-911 Director for Russell County, said they chose the GeoConex system because “it was easy to use yet powerful enough to produce the accurate, polished product we required.”

When the time came to replace the phone system, “GeoConex came back with both a competitive bid and a creative financing proposal” according to Director Rod Powell, who purchased two Zetron MAX CT controllers from the authorized resellers.  The Zetron MAX CT offers a full range of features and functionality including: intelligent user interface, automatic call recovery, low power consumption, high reliability and cost-effective scalability, digital end-to-end IP, and remote access and maintenance. 

With the phone system upgrade, Russell County also installed GeoConex®’s Next Generation Viewer. Viewer is a data access and decision support solution for emergency response organizations, running standalone or integrated with your computer-aided dispatch software. GeoConex® Next Generation Viewer instantaneously displays the mapped location, with or without aerial photographs, along with other mission-critical information. This information can include details on callers, residents, utilities, and other geographic information system (GIS) entities such as fire-hydrant locations—even hazardous material and historical medical and event data. Using GeoConex® Next Generation Viewer, dispatchers are able to quickly and efficiently provide routing assistance and important landmark information to emergency response personnel. In addition, they can identify where a location lies in relation to the road or existing structure.
